Locke Looking Like Less Of a Lock

The rumored successor to Bill Richardson and Judd Gregg as the next doomed Commerce Secretary nominee is former Washington Governor Gary Locke.

Lest you worry that Locke has his own closeted deal-breakers, the Washington Post assures us:

Locke is regarded as a safe choice by senior officials in the Obama administration given his long history in public life, his strait-laced reputation and his bipartisan governing credentials.

And lest you believe the Washington Post, Michelle Malkin disabuses us of the fantasy of Locke's straight laces.

Money laundering, illegal campaign contributions, pay-for-play scandals... this guy's the whole package.
